Quarterly Planning Note — Board Copy

Ternbrook Instruments will retire the Ferox gauge line at year-end. Margins have fallen below threshold for three consecutive quarters. Remaining stock to be sold through distributors; support continues twelve months. Engineering reallocates to the Calder platform. Associated headcount moves are handled separately. The confidential note below states the strategic intent.

internal memo for yahag-tahog: The pricing group signed off on a budget of $152.8 million for Project Soriel.

- [ ] **Step 7: Breaker override escrow.** After sealing the signing keys for the Tallgrove upstream API circuit breaker, confirm the support team can force the breaker open during a full outage. The override bundle lives in the sealed escrow drawer and is useless without its unlock phrase. Two ceremony witnesses must initial this step before proceeding. The escrow bundle is decrypted with the recovery passphrase that follows.

vault phrase of kahip-kahop = holath-quenmir

## Service Accounts — Incremental Rebuilds

The Thornbury static site doesn't rebuild from scratch anymore; the `pagesmith-bot` service account triggers incremental rebuilds whenever content lands in the Quarry CMS. If rebuilds stall, it's almost always this account's token, not the builder itself. Don't create new accounts — reuse this one and note it in the changelog. Its key for the rebuild service is below.

app token of yajof-fajof = zpat11_OrsDd3gqCaG

Quarterly Planning Note — For the Board

Quick update on the possible acquisition of Larkspur Analytics. Early diligence looks encouraging: solid recurring revenue, a small but capable team, and tech that slots neatly alongside our Veltro platform. Valuation chatter is still wide, so we're keeping expectations in check. Legal is scoping exclusivity terms now. We'd like an informal read from the board before formal talks. The confidential note below sets out the strategic rationale.

board note of fahog-bawep: The renewal with Holixax Holdings closes at $20 million a year, 20 percent below the last contract. Project Druwyn slips by two quarters because of the supplier delay.